Custom supply is not the same as standard sourcing

A standard product order is relatively simple. The buyer selects a model, confirms basic specifications, requests samples, and checks delivery. But custom resistive touch screen supply is different. Even if the required change seems small, the project often involves a chain of decisions tied together.

A customer may need:

  • a different outer dimension
  • a modified active area
  • a different FPC position
  • a different connector type
  • a specific thickness
  • a different 4-wire or 5-wire structure
  • matching with an existing controller board
  • better fit with a device housing
  • stable supply for a long product lifecycle

At that point, the project is no longer just about buying a screen. It becomes a coordination task between design, engineering, production, testing, and long-term supply management. A source factory is generally in a better position to handle that kind of work because it controls more of the process directly.

A source factory shortens the decision path

One of the biggest differences between a source factory and a non-manufacturing supplier is decision speed. In custom supply, many questions cannot be answered well through repeated relays between sales layers. If the buyer needs to confirm drawing feasibility, tail direction, structure adjustment, or production limits, the response needs to come from people close to actual manufacturing.

When the supplier is a source factory, the decision path is shorter:

  • sales can communicate with engineering directly
  • engineering can check production feasibility faster
  • production can confirm process impact earlier
  • quality teams can evaluate inspection points before mass production
  • project changes can be reviewed with fewer communication gaps

This matters because OEM projects rarely move in a straight line. Drawings are updated. Enclosures change. Mounting conditions shift. Buyers often adjust details after prototype testing. A source factory is better equipped to respond to those changes without losing project rhythm.

Custom projects need engineering support, not only quotations

A reliable custom supplier should do more than send a price sheet and lead time estimate. In resistive touch screen projects, many of the important decisions happen before order placement. The supplier needs to understand how the screen fits into the full product.

For example, a buyer may need a custom resistive touch screen for:

  • an industrial control panel
  • a handheld test device
  • a medical instrument
  • a self-service terminal
  • a POS machine
  • an equipment upgrade project

In each case, the engineering concerns are different. The screen may need to fit a narrow bezel opening, align with an older motherboard, match a metal housing, or maintain stable operation under glove use. These issues cannot be solved by catalog comparison alone.

A source factory can usually provide better support in areas such as:

  • drawing review
  • structure confirmation
  • tolerance analysis
  • interface matching
  • controller coordination
  • sample refinement
  • project record management

That kind of support often makes the difference between a screen that is merely available and a screen that is actually usable in production.

Product consistency matters after the sample stage

Many suppliers can provide a good sample. The harder part is maintaining consistency after approval. In OEM supply, the sample is only the beginning. Buyers need confidence that the same structure, touch response, appearance, and interface quality will continue in repeat orders.

This is one of the strongest advantages of working with a source factory. Because production is handled directly, the factory can usually manage process consistency more effectively. That includes:

  • raw material control
  • production workflow management
  • inspection standard consistency
  • process traceability
  • batch-to-batch stability

For custom resistive touch screens, this is especially important. A slight variation in size, connector placement, or touch performance can affect final assembly or device function. If the project is part of an OEM equipment line, even small inconsistencies can create rework on the customer side.

A factory partner that understands this risk is more valuable than a supplier focused only on shipping confirmed items.

Source factories are usually better at documentation control

Another area where source factories often perform better is documentation continuity. In custom touch projects, documentation is part of the supply itself. Buyers may need to refer back to drawings, structure changes, sample records, validation notes, or previous project versions months later.

A source factory is more likely to keep these details connected to real production data. That makes it easier to:

  • repeat the same custom specification
  • confirm changes against earlier versions
  • manage model upgrades
  • reduce confusion in reorder stages
  • support long-cycle supply projects

This becomes increasingly important for industrial and commercial equipment, where product lifecycles are often much longer than in consumer electronics.

A good source factory helps reduce hidden project costs

Even when buyers are not focused on component price, they still care deeply about total project cost. In custom sourcing, hidden costs often come from delay, miscommunication, redesign, unstable quality, or poor sample conversion.

For example, a supplier that cannot confirm structure issues early may cause repeated sample revisions. A supplier that lacks production discipline may create inconsistencies in mass orders. A supplier that does not retain project details well may create avoidable problems during reorder cycles.

These issues do not always show up in the first quotation, but they have real impact on:

  • engineering workload
  • launch timing
  • assembly efficiency
  • after-sales support
  • replacement planning
  • overall supply chain reliability

A source factory is often a better partner because it can reduce these indirect risks, not just provide the product itself.

Long-term cooperation is easier when the factory understands the application

Custom resistive touch screen projects are often not one-time jobs. Buyers may start with one device model, then extend the same structure to multiple sizes or product series. They may need replacement supply for years. They may also need adjustments as their product evolves.

A source factory is usually better suited to grow with that process because it has more visibility into the technical background of the project. Over time, that can lead to better cooperation in:

  • model extension
  • version updates
  • engineering adjustments
  • reorder support
  • replacement part continuity
  • application-specific optimization

This kind of partnership matters a lot in industrial, medical, retail, and equipment markets where long-term product stability is a real business requirement.

What buyers should look for in a factory partner

If the project requires custom resistive touch screen supply, buyers should not stop at asking whether the supplier can customize. They should look deeper into how the supplier works.

Useful questions include:

  • Does the supplier have direct production capability?
  • Can engineering communicate clearly on drawings and structure details?
  • Is there a quality system behind mass production?
  • Can the supplier support repeat orders consistently?
  • Are project records managed clearly for long-cycle cooperation?
  • Does the supplier understand the end-use application?

The more complete these answers are, the more likely the supplier is to become a dependable partner instead of just a temporary vendor.
